What is the most massive part of an atom? area outside the nucleus nucleus neutrons protons

Respuesta :

trinawallace47 trinawallace47
  • 23-10-2019

Answer:

The Nucleus in the centre of the atom.

The rest of the atom is made up of nothing except from a few electrons, which have a much lower mass than either protons or neutrons.
